I haven't been, but read good things about Uncle Liu's Hot Pot in Merrifield. You may also wish to take them to Eden Center where IMO the food is more authentic than Present or 4 Sisters (both of which I love dearly).
For Japanese, Tachibana and Sushi Yoshi are the gold standards in NoVA. Really no need to drive into town for Japanese. Other cuisines may be a different story. And, of course, you MUST go to Rasika for Indian.
